The Clinical Documentation Specialist is responsible for assisting in the improvement of the overall quality and completeness of provider-based clinical documentation in the medical record. The Specialist will conduct ongoing, concurrent analyses of clinical information in collaboration with physicians, nursing staff, and other patient caregivers to accurately reflect the severity of illness of the patient as well as the level of services rendered. Requirements:Two-year associate degree or four-year bachelor's degree in nursing.Applicable clinical or professional certifications and licenses such as RHIT, RHIA, CCS, CPC, CCDS, CDIP, RN, LPN required.Minimum of two years related work experience in an acute care setting.Clinical, nursing, Health Information Management, and Clinical Documentation experience preferred.Proficiency in a medical record review.Responsibilities:Facilitates appropriate clinical documentation to support correct diagnosis coding and ensure the level of service rendered to all patients is documented.Communicates with physicians, nurse practitioners, case managers, coders, and other members of the care team to facilitate comprehensive medical record documentation to reflect treatment, decision-making and medical documentation.Assigns a working DRG and severity level using coding rules and guidelines with follow-up reviews as required by length of stay prior to discharge.Analyzes clinical information to identify areas within the chart for potential gaps in physician documentation.Queries physicians on a concurrent basis, monitors the query response from the physician, documents the physician response in 3M, and closes out the analyst's review if prior to discharge.Formulates credible clinical documentation clarifications to improve clinical documentation of principal diagnosis, co-morbidities, present on admission (POA), quality core measures, and patient safety indicators.Works with Physician Advisor and CDI Manager to resolve documentation discrepancies and clinical disparities.Monitors and track trends in clinical documentation, identifying areas for improvement and ensuring compliance with internal and external standards.Any other duties as assigned by Woman's Hospital.Schedule:Monday - Friday / Hybrid Schedule 8:00 AM - 4:30 PMPay Range:Salary/Exempt$30.00 - $44.00A Work Experience with PurposeWoman's is one of the largest specialty hospitals for women and infants in the United States.
